statmanhensley Posted February 23, 2009 Posted February 23, 2009 Where do I get videos in that format? Or how to I convert my videos to those formats? You can convert them with http://www.mediaconverter.org That is the site I use for all of my converting. They used to have a downloadable program that I have on my computer but I think they've gone away from it. I do know that they limit you to a total of 5 conversions per day so you have to be sure that you convert them properly the first time or two or you'll have to wait an entire extra day. Oh and there is a file size limit that they'll convert....not sure what it is though.
